Western music blends the rugged spirit of the American frontier with folk, country, and cinematic influences. Rooted in storytelling, it often features acoustic guitars, fiddles, harmonicas, and rich vocal harmonies that evoke open landscapes and outlaw tales. Modern Western artists incorporate blues, rock, and even orchestral elements, creating a diverse yet nostalgic soundscape. From dusty, twang-filled ballads to sweeping Spaghetti Western instrumentals, the genre embraces themes of adventure, perseverance, and life on the range, keeping cowboy culture alive in contemporary music.
